                              ok heres a short run of whats going on with it.


                              no matter how cold or hot it is, WOT boggs down completely. in neutral it will rev to appx 3000, but beyond that will bogg and backfire in the air filter. Every mechanic almost that has come in contact with this car says its timing. The timing chain was done less than 2k miles ago. it was off 2 teeth. no it is corrected. timing or whatever it is still seems to be WAY the fuck off. I am so agrivated because its so georgous and i cant enjoy it. I have a decent amount of money into the car so i would preffer to drive it as almost a daily driver (it owes me that much)

                              what has been done:

                              fuel pump/filter/tuneup. Car holds pressure at the right PSI for fuel. Bmap is functioning. TPS is non functional. car also seems to be overheating???? i have a bad heater core and an extremely hard hose just mins after starting the engine.
